@ -44,6 +44,14 @@ Backward-incompatible changes
- :meth:`~scrapy.spidermiddlewares.referer.ReferrerPolicy.referrer`
- :meth:`scrapy.downloadermiddlewares.robotstxt.RobotsTxtMiddleware.process_request`
now returns a coroutine, previously it returned a
:class:`~twisted.internet.defer.Deferred` object or ``None``. The
``robot_parser()`` method was also changed to return a coroutine. This
change only impacts code that subclasses
:class:`~scrapy.downloadermiddlewares.robotstxt.RobotsTxtMiddleware` or
calls its methods directly.
